## Alert: StatRelay Sidecar Flush Lag

This alert fires when the StatRelay metrics-aggregation sidecar falls more than 120 seconds behind on flushing buffered samples to the Coalmine backend. Plugin-emitted counters are buffered in-process, so sustained lag usually means a plugin is emitting unbounded label cardinality or blocking the flush thread. Check your plugin's metric registration against the published cardinality limits before escalating. If the lag persists after your plugin is ruled out, contact the telemetry team.

escalation mailbox, bagug-fahof: novdor.wendor.jormir@norvalabs.example

**Wiki: Artifact signing for QuillPress incremental rebuilds**

Every incremental rebuild of a QuillPress site produces a signed artifact; edge nodes refuse unsigned deltas. If a customer reports partial page updates, first confirm the artifact signature matches the active publishing identity. The identity currently accepted by the rebuild pipeline is listed below.

signing key of kagaf-fahap = bky3_CfS

Leadership Review Briefing — Budget Request

Quick version for the board: the Marrowell team is asking for an extra 280k to accelerate the Pinefold rollout. Most of it covers tooling and two contract engineers through year-end. Honestly, the payback case looks solid — roughly fourteen months. We'd like a decision before the offsite. Here's the thinking behind the ask.

confidential, bahap-bajog: Zorethix Works is in early talks to buy Kelethox Foods for about $30.7 million. The Ralvan launch date is September 19, and nothing goes to the press before then.

# SDK Parity Settings — Bramblewire Platform
#
# Plugin authors: this file governs feature-flag parity between the
# Bramblewire Kotlin SDK and the Swift SDK. Each flag listed under
# `parity.enforced` must ship in both SDKs in the same release train;
# the parity checker fails the build otherwise. If you add a flag for
# one SDK only, register it under `parity.exempt` with an expiry date.
# The checker records audit results in a shared database, which it
# reaches using the connection string below.

primary connection of yagep-kahip = redis://giliel_svc:zYiKsLL2PLpfPL@db-348f.xolmarsys.corp:5432/fenwyn